A compound is composed of 5.045g of carbon, 0.847g of hydrogen and 3.36g of oxygen. Find the empirical formula for this compound knowing that H = 1g/mole , O = 16g/mole and C =12 g/mole.

"\\begin{matrix}\n &C&H&O\\\\moles&\\frac{5.045}{12}&0.847&\\frac{3.36}{16}\n \\\\ratio&2.00&4.03&1.00\\\\mole\\>ratio&2&4&1\n\\end{matrix}"


Empirical Formula"=C_2H_4O"
